feat(tickets map): ticket-stub markers instead of generic teardrop

Replace the canvas teardrop pin with an admission-ticket silhouette (side
perforation notches + a dashed tear line, tapering to a bottom point that
anchors on the location) drawn via Path2D at 4x (pixelRatio 4). Keeps every
existing rule: fill = SLA colour, vivid = open / pastel = closed, white outline,
bottom anchor, and the fan-out declutter. Markers now read clearly as tickets
and are distinct from the round vehicle markers.
